About this listen

Dartmoor. A wild, wet place in the south-west of England. A place where it is easy to get lost, and to fall into the soft green earth which can pull the strongest man down to his death. A man is running for his life. Behind him comes an enormous dog - a dog from his worst dreams, a dog from hell. Between him and a terrible death stands only one person - the greatest detective of all time, Sherlock Holmes. An Oxford Bookworms Library reader for learners of English, adapted from the Sir Arthur Conan Doyle original by Patrick Nobes.
